Autolus Therapeutics reported a landmark second quarter for fiscal 2026, with revenue from its AUCATZYL CAR-T cell therapy surging 119% compared to the prior-year period โ a growth rate that reflects both the maturation of its commercial infrastructure and expanding physician adoption across authorized treatment centers. The company also raised its full-year 2026 revenue outlook, a move that sends a strong signal to the market about the durability of AUCATZYL's commercial launch trajectory. AUCATZYL targets relapsed or refractory B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ia, a high-unmet-need indication with limited effective options for patients who have failed prior therapies.

CAR-T therapies face notoriously challenging commercialization pathways โ requiring specialized certified treatment centers, complex manufacturing logistics, and intensive patient monitoring protocols. Autolus's 119% revenue growth suggests the company is successfully navigating these structural hurdles, with a growing network of clinical sites gaining experience with AUCATZYL's administration. The expansion of treatment center certifications and the maturation of patient referral pathways typically drive accelerating commercial curves for CAR-T products, and Autolus's results indicate it is firmly on this trajectory.
The guidance raise carries significant weight for a commercial-stage biotech still consuming substantial cash to fund operations. Investors will scrutinize whether AUCATZYL's growth is driven by genuine patient demand or front-loaded center stocking, and whether gross-to-net dynamics โ the difference between list price and actual realized revenue after rebates and adjustments โ are tracking in line with expectations. International regulatory progress in Europe and additional label expansion opportunities will also be key catalysts. For now, the 119% revenue growth and upward guidance revision cement Autolus's credibility as a viable commercial-stage cell therapy company.
